The Composition of Chocolate Kisses

Chocolate kisses, a product made by Hershey’s, are small, drop-shaped pieces of milk chocolate. They contain a blend of sugar, milk, cocoa butter, lactose, milk protein concentrate, and less than 2% of lecithin, PGPR, emulsifier, and vanillin, an artificial flavor. The specific composition can affect how the chocolate melts, as different ingredients have different melting points and can influence the overall melting behavior of the chocolate.

Influence of Cocoa Butter

Cocoa butter, a significant component of chocolate, plays a crucial role in its melting properties. Pure cocoa butter has a sharp melting point of around 35-40°C (95-104°F), which is close to human body temperature. This is why chocolate can melt in your hands or mouth. However, chocolate kisses and other commercial chocolates often have a slightly higher melting point due to the addition of other ingredients and processing methods that affect the crystalline structure of the cocoa butter.

Chocolate Kisses in Baked Goods

When using chocolate kisses in baked goods like cookies, cakes, or muffins, they can melt to varying degrees depending on the baking temperature and time. For example, in a cookie recipe baked at a moderate temperature (around 375°F or 190°C) for 10-12 minutes, the chocolate kisses might retain some of their shape but will likely be melted and gooey on the inside. In contrast, higher oven temperatures or longer baking times can cause the chocolate to melt completely, distributing throughout the dough.

Tips for Using Chocolate Kisses in Baking

To achieve the best results when using chocolate kisses in your oven-baked creations:
Adjust the baking time and temperature according to the specific recipe and the desired outcome for the chocolate.
Position the chocolate kisses strategically in your baked goods. For instance, placing them towards the top can help them retain their shape as they melt slightly, creating a nice appearance and texture contrast.
Consider the type of chocolate you’re using. Darker chocolates with higher cocoa content tend to have a higher melting point than milk chocolate, which means they might retain their shape better in the oven.

Cooking Techniques to Manage Melting

Several cooking techniques can help manage how chocolate kisses melt in your baked goods. For example, using a lower oven temperature can help control the melting process, allowing for a more gradual and predictable outcome. Additionally, freezing the chocolate kisses before adding them to your dough can temporarily prevent them from melting, giving you more control over the final texture of your baked goods.

How do you store chocolate kisses to maintain their texture and flavor?

To maintain the texture and flavor of chocolate kisses, it’s essential to store them in a cool, dry place away from direct sunlight and heat sources. The ideal storage temperature for chocolate kisses is between 60°F (15°C) and 70°F (21°C), with a relative humidity of less than 50%. You can store chocolate kisses in an airtight container, such as a glass jar or plastic container, to protect them from moisture and other environmental factors.

Proper storage conditions can help preserve the texture and flavor of chocolate kisses for several months.
